Shopify Engineering

Making Open Source Safer for Everyone with Shop...
Zack Deveau, Senior Application Security Engineer at Shopify, shares the details behind a recent contribution to the Rails library, inspired by a bug bounty report we received. He'll go over...
Making Open Source Safer for Everyone with Shop...
Zack Deveau, Senior Application Security Engineer at Shopify, shares the details behind a recent contribution to the Rails library, inspired by a bug bounty report we received. He'll go over...

How We Built Shopify Party
Shopify Party is a browser-based internal tool that we built to make our virtual hangouts more fun. With Shopify’s move to remote, we wanted to explore how to give people...
How We Built Shopify Party
Shopify Party is a browser-based internal tool that we built to make our virtual hangouts more fun. With Shopify’s move to remote, we wanted to explore how to give people...

8 Data Conferences Shopify Data Thinks You Shou...
Our mission at Shopify is to make commerce better for everyone. Doing this in the long term requires constant learning and development – which happen to be core values here...
8 Data Conferences Shopify Data Thinks You Shou...
Our mission at Shopify is to make commerce better for everyone. Doing this in the long term requires constant learning and development – which happen to be core values here...

The Journey to Cloud Development: How Shopify W...
How we reinvented our developer environment by going cloud native to keep up with increasing complexity and exponential growth.
The Journey to Cloud Development: How Shopify W...
How we reinvented our developer environment by going cloud native to keep up with increasing complexity and exponential growth.

Building a Form with Polaris
As companies grow in size and complexity, there comes a moment in time when teams realize the need to standardize portions of their codebase. This most often becomes the impetus...
Building a Form with Polaris
As companies grow in size and complexity, there comes a moment in time when teams realize the need to standardize portions of their codebase. This most often becomes the impetus...

To Thread or Not to Thread: An In-Depth Look at...
Deploying Ruby applications using threaded servers has become widely considered as standard practice in recent years. According to the 2022 Ruby on Rails community survey, in which over 2,600 members...
To Thread or Not to Thread: An In-Depth Look at...
Deploying Ruby applications using threaded servers has become widely considered as standard practice in recent years. According to the 2022 Ruby on Rails community survey, in which over 2,600 members...